Kale Cannelloni

  1. Brown meat with onions and garlic in large skillet; cool.
  2. Meanwhile, add kale to large pan of boiling water; cook 2 min.
  3. Drain; immediately add to bowl of ice water.
  4. Remove from ice water; drain well.
  5. Carefully open kale leaves; place on clean kitchen towels, pressing lightly to flatten.
  6. Cover with additional towels; pat gently to remove excess water.
  7. Heat oven to 350F.
  8. Pour pasta sauce into 13x9-inch baking dish sprayed with cooking spray.
  9. Add 1/2 cup mozzarella, Parmesan and egg to meat mixture; mix well.
  10. Spoon onto kale leaves, adding about 3 Tbsp.
  11. to each.
  12. Tuck in both short ends of each leaf, then roll up starting at one long side.
  13. Place, seam sides down, over sauce in dish; top with remaining mozzarella.
  14. Cover with foil.
  15. Bake 45 min.
  16. or until heated through, uncovering for the last 10 min.
